Best Theater Company Birthday Party Venues in Plymouth
1 venue of Plymouth, England
Theater Company
Showing 1 venue of 1
Just inside Devonport Park at the corner of Milne Place and, Exmouth Rd, Plymouth PL1 4QH, United Kingdom
4.8
(154 reviews)